GRANTS TO LOCAL EDUCATIONAL AGENCIES

809. (a) The Commissioner is authorized to make grants to 20 USC 3289. local educational agencies for the Federal share of the cost of planning, establishing, expanding, and operating community education programs including any use described in section 807, whenever the Commissioner determines, pursuant to an application filed under paragraph (2), that the community education program for which application is made under subsection (b) holds reasonable promise of success and is in substantial compliance with the requirements of section 808 (a)(4). (5), (6),and (7). (b) Xo grant may be made under this section unless an application is made to the Commissioner at such time, in such manner, and containing or accompanied by such information, as the Commissioner may reasonably require. "(c) There are authorized to be appropriated $20,000,000 for fiscal Appropriation year 1979, $25,000,000 for fiscal year 1980, $30,000,000 for fiscal year authorization. 1981, $25,000,000 for fiscal year 1982, and $20,000,000 for fiscal year 1983 to carry out the provisions of this section. "GRANTS TO PUBLIC AGENCIES AND NONPROFIT ORGANIZATIONS FOR DELIVERY OF C 0 5 I M U N I T Y SERVICES THROUGH COMMUNITY EDUCATION

"SEC. 810. (a) The Commissioner is authorized to make grants to 20 USC 3290. and contracts with public agencies and nonprofit private organizations to encourage the use of school facilities and other facilities eligible to receive assistance under this title for the efficient and coordinated delivery of community services set forth in sections 806(b) and 807. Kach such application shall contain provisions to assure that the public agency or nonprofit private organization making application has entered or will enter into contractual arrangements or other suitable forms of agreement with the local educational agency concerned. "(b) Xo grant may be made under the provisions of this section unless an application is made to the Commissioner at such time, in such manner and containing or accompanied by such information, as • the Commissioner may reasonably require. "(c) There are authorized to be appropriated $5,000,000 for fiscal Appropriation year 1979. $7,000,000 for fiscal year 1980, $10,000,000 for fiscal year authorization. 1981, $7,000,000 for fiscal year 1982, and $5,000,000 for fiscal year 1983 to carry out the provisions of this section.
